Step-by-Step Implementation Guide
Let's walk through the complete setup process. I'll break this down into manageable phases.
Phase 1: WhatsApp Business Setup (15 minutes)
Prerequisites: Before you start, you'll need:
WhatsApp Business account (you can create this if you don't have one)
Meta Business Manager access
Business verification completed
Step 1: Verify Your WhatsApp Business Account
If you don't already have a verified WhatsApp Business account:
# Via Meta Business Manager
1. Go to business.facebook.com
2. Business Settings → Accounts → WhatsApp Business Accounts
3. Click "Add" → "Create a new WhatsApp Business Account"
4. Enter your business phone number
5. Verify phone ownership via SMS or voice call
6. Complete business verification (upload business documents)Step 2: Enable Voice Calling on Your WhatsApp Number
Once you have a verified WhatsApp Business account:
# In Meta Business Manager
1. Go to Business Settings → Accounts → WhatsApp Business Accounts
2. Select your phone number
3. Click "Account Tools" → "Phone Numbers"
4. Click on your phone number to open details
5. Go to the "Call Settings" tab
6. Toggle "Allow Voice Calls" to ENABLED
7. Save changesStep 3: Create a Meta Developer App
To access WhatsApp Business API:
# Via Meta for Developers
1. Go to developers.facebook.com
2. Click "Create App"
3. App type: Select "Business"
4. App name: Enter a name (e.g., "My Business WhatsApp Integration")
5. Contact email: Your business email
6. Click "Create App"
7. On the app dashboard, find "WhatsApp" in the products section
8. Click "Set up" next to WhatsApp
9. Select "Other" when asked about app use cases (or select your category)
10. Complete the setup wizard
11. Once setup is complete, refresh the page
12. You'll see "WhatsApp" in the left sidebar, click it
13. Click "Start using the API"Step 4: Generate Access Token and Phone Number ID
# In the WhatsApp API Setup section
1. Select your verified phone number from the dropdown
2. Click "Generate Access Token"
3. Copy the access token (save this securely, you'll need it)
4. Copy the Phone Number ID (you'll need this too)
IMPORTANT: Treat your access token like a password. Don't share it publicly.Phase 1 Complete: You now have WhatsApp Business API access with voice calling enabled.

Common Challenges and Solutions
Challenge 1: "AI Doesn't Understand Our Customers"
Reality Check: Modern speech recognition is excellent, but no system is perfect. The key is graceful handling of uncertainty.
Solution:
Confidence thresholds: If AI is less than 70% confident it understands, ask for clarification
Natural clarification: "I'm sorry, could you repeat that? I want to make sure I understand correctly."
Context awareness: Use previous parts of the conversation to disambiguate
Knowledge base expansion: Add common phrases and variations customers use
Challenge 2: "Customers Want to Speak to a Human"
Reality Check: Some customers will always prefer human interaction. That's okay. Provide easy escalation.
Solution:
Always offer escalation: "Say 'representative' anytime to speak with someone."
Make it obvious in greeting: "I can help with [X, Y, Z]. Say 'representative' if you'd like to speak with someone."
Smooth transfers: When transferring, give context: "I'm connecting you with Sarah, who can help with billing. She knows you're calling about an invoice question."
Track escalations: Monitor why customers ask for humans and improve AI in those areas
Challenge 3: "Integration with Our Systems Is Complex"
Solution:
Start simple: Don't integrate everything at once. Start with read-only (looking up data)
Use pre-built integrations: VoiceInfra can connect with Google Calendar, Salesforce, HubSpot, etc.
Custom API integration: VoiceInfra's CURL Function Creator lets you connect to any REST API without coding
Email fallback: Worst case, have AI collect information and email it to your team
Challenge 4: "We're Concerned About Data Privacy"
Valid concern. Here's how to handle it:
Solution:
End-to-end encryption: All communications are encrypted
Configurable data retention: Set how long call transcripts are stored
Access controls: Restrict who can view call logs and transcripts
Explicit consent: AI can ask for permission before accessing sensitive data
Challenge 5: "What If AI Makes a Mistake?"
Solution:
Confirmation for important actions: "Just to confirm, you want to cancel your appointment on Tuesday at 2 PM. Is that correct?"
Human review for high-stakes: Payments, cancellations, or sensitive data can require human approval
Confidence-based escalation: If AI is <70% confident, ask for clarification or transfer
Start with low-risk use cases: Begin with appointments, FAQs, business hours, not payments or cancellations
Daily monitoring: Review call transcripts to catch and fix issues quickly
Measuring Success
Track these metrics to know if your WhatsApp Voice AI is working:
Customer Experience Metrics
Call answer rate (should be 95%+, AI answers almost every call)
Call completion rate (% of calls that complete without transfer)
Average call duration (should be 1-3 minutes for simple tasks)
Customer satisfaction (ask "How was your experience? 1-5"), aim for 80%+
First-call resolution (% of issues resolved in one call)
Operational Metrics
% of calls handled by AI (start with 50-70%, aim for 80%+)
Average time to answer (AI answers in under 2 seconds)
After-hours calls handled (should capture 90%+ of after-hours calls)
Staff time saved (track reduction in time on phone)
Business Impact Metrics
Revenue from previously missed calls (after-hours appointments, etc.)
Customer retention (compare before/after AI implementation)
Cost per call (AI calls should cost 0.10-0.50 vs 3-6 for humans)
Customer acquisition (are new customers choosing you for 24/7 support?)
AI Performance Metrics
Intent recognition accuracy (Does AI understand what the customer wants?)
Knowledge base coverage (% of questions AI can answer)
Transfer rate (% of calls transferred to humans, lower is better, but 10-20% is normal)
Escalation reasons (why do customers ask for humans? Use this to improve AI)
